LG06 LYT is a 2006 Maserati Quattroporte in Grey with a 4,244c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 22 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 77.3%.
Across all 2006 Maserati Quattroporte models, the average MOT pass rate is 78.7% with a typical mileage of 47,734 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Maserati Quattroporte f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 639 recorded failures. If you're considering buying LG06 LYT,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Maserati Quattroporte typically stays on UK roads for around 27 years. At 20 years old, this Maserati Quattroporte is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
